Strains 'MaB-QuH-8' were either derived from an M. aquifolia plant (MaB-QuH-8) from a collection of plant material in Brazil. Agar slant cultures on oatmeal agar (g/l: oatmeal 20, agar 20; pH 7.0-7.2) were used to propagate an inoculum culture on a medium composed as follows (g/l): D-glucose 15, soy flour 15, CaCO3 1; KH2PO4 3, NaCl 5;pH 6.5. Cultivation occurred in 500-ml Erlenmeyer flasks containing 100 ml medium for 72 h at 28 ℃ and 180 rpm on a rotary shaker. A 5-ml aliquot of this starting culture was used to inoculate 500-ml Erlenmeyer flasks containing 100 ml of a medium composed as follows (g/l): D-glucose 10, maltose 20, soytone 2, yeast extract 1, KH2PO4 1, MgSO4.7H2O 0.5; pH 5.5 (prior to sterilization). The cultivation was carried out for 96 h at 28 ℃ on rotary shakers (180 rpm).
